Shoaib Akhtar has called Babar Azam a “fraud” as the Pakistan batter continues to struggle for form, with his latest failure coming against arch-rivals India in the Champions Trophy 2025. Babar has only scored one fifty in the last five matches and has been under severe criticism from experts in Pakistan after they lost to India on Sunday.

Team India thrashed Pakistan by six wickets in a Champions Trophy 2025 group stage match in Dubai and are unbeaten against their neighbours since 2018 in ODIs.

In the aftermath of another loss for Pakistan, former pacer Akhtar put the spotlight on the unfair comparison between Virat Kohli and Babar. Kohli hit an unbeaten century in India’s latest win over Pakistan.

Akhtar said Babar has been following wrong examples all along and his batting has been exposed. “We always compare Babar Azam to Virat Kohli. Now tell me who is hero of Virat Kohli? Sachin Tendulkar and he has scored 100 centuries and Virat is chasing his legacy,” Akhtar said on the Pakistani show “Game On Hai.”

“Who is Babar Azam’s hero? Tuk tuk (name not shared by Akhtar). You have picked the wrong heroes. Your thought process is wrong. You were a fraud from the beginning.”

Akhtar also said that he doesn’t wish to talk about the Pakistan cricket team but is forced to do so as he has taken up the job of an expert.

“I would not even wish to talk about Pakistan cricket team. I am only doing this because I am getting paid,” he said. “This is a waste of time. This deterioration I am seeing since 2001. I have worked with the captains, whose personality used to change thrice a day.”

Akhtar reserved special praise for Kohli, who brought up his 51st century against Pakistan. “We have seen this in the past. When you tell Virat Kohli that he has to play against Pakistan, he will score a century. Hats off to him, he’s like a superstar,” Akhtar added.

“He’s a white ball run chaser. Modern-day great. No doubt about him. I’m very happy for him. He deserves all the praise."

Pakistan have since been knocked out of the Champions Trophy 2025 as New Zealand and India qualified for the semi-finals from Group A of the tournament.
